  • Abstract
    In bilateral teleoperation systems, stability and synchronization have been important problems in control engineering. Several control architectures have been developed to solve these problems. In addition to them, we consider an effect of input saturation on the system. Saturation generally can destroy synchronization within the established architecture. In this paper, we propose a new control scheme guaranteeing that all signals are ultimately bounded in the time delayed system. Furthermore, if there is no time delay, synchronization can be proved. Simulation results are presented to verify the effectiveness of the proposed architecture.
